Abstract

The invention relates to the technical field of quarantine, in particular to an intelligent quarantine channel and a method, wherein the intelligent quarantine channel comprises the following components: the switch, test and put host computer, embedded controller and spray and the gauze mask system, the switch, test and put host computer, embedded controller and spray and the gauze mask system connects gradually, the switch still is connected with infrared thermometer to with the data transmission that infrared thermometer gathered to test and put the host computer, spray and the gauze mask system includes automatic spraying system and automatic bullet gauze mask system, can improve the speed of testing and putting of quarantine passageway, guarantee the rate of accuracy that detects, reduce staff and passenger's contact, improve the security.

Background technology
At present, existing inspection and quarantine groundwork mode is artificial screening, by the body temperature of all passengers in the hygrosensor detection visual field, and transfer data to computer, by the way of computer is reported to the police and combined artificial screening, determine abnormal body temperature passenger, carry out next step investigation via artificial interception, thus have the disadvantage in that peak period passenger is many, crowd moves in the moment, and staff finds heating passenger's difficulty big in crowd;Increasing staff's burden, investigation is not accurate, and easily makes mistakes;Staff needs directly to contact with passenger, is not easy to the control of epidemic situation.

As in figure 2 it is shown, from outward appearance, described intelligence quarantine passage includes front door gate machine 1 and rear door gate machine 2, is provided above infrared radiation thermometer 3 at front door gate machine 1 and rear door gate machine 2, and other functional modules are arranged on the inside of intelligence quarantine passage, not shown in Fig. 2.
In the present embodiment, also including power supply box, described power supply box is put main frame, embedded controller, infrared radiation thermometer, nuclear radiation detection device and blackbody radiation source standard set-up be connected with being tested respectively.
In the present embodiment, power supply box powers to whole channel unit, by the control of embedded controller, partial power is switched over simultaneously, before intelligence quarantine passage uses, open front door gate machine power supply, rear door gate machine power supply by a key switch machine, test and put host power supply, embedded controller power supply, infrared radiation thermometer power supply, nuclear radiation detection device power supply and the power supply of blackbody radiation source standard set-up;Afterwards, logging in test by certificate identification and fingerprint login system and put main frame, with related hardware communication, described certificate identification and fingerprint login system are additionally operable to certificate registration.
The data that infrared radiation thermometer and nuclear radiation detection device collect are sent to test through switch puts main frame, main frame self-service identification human body temperature is put or whether radioprotective data exceed standard by testing, and send commands to embedded controller, control automatic sprinkler fire-extinguishing system and appliance for releasing single mask system.
In the present embodiment, alarm lamp control signal, guiding lamp control signal are exported by the I/O mouth of embedded controller.
In the present embodiment, sensor signal is input to embedded controller, then transmits to testing the particular location putting main frame realization detection passenger, it is achieved the functions such as anti-pinch.

In the present embodiment, appliance for releasing single mask system is the self-service dispensing device of a set of mask, current intelligence quarantine passage can be integrated in, the self-service dispenser of mask has mask quantity detection function, send prompting when mask quantity is low and increase mouth-muffle function, network remote control can be realized simultaneously, remotely real-time monitoring, detect that human body can send a control command to embedded controller when needing and isolate when detecting system simultaneously, order is analyzed processing by embedded controller, communication is carried out with appliance for releasing single mask system, read the quantity of current mask, when mask quantity meets allocation condition, send and play mask order, whether detection mask is allotted successfully simultaneously;And detecting the quantity of mask in real time, when mask quantity is less than 5, prompting needs to put mask, when mask quantity is 0, does not works, until being operated when mask is deposited full.
In the present embodiment, automatic sprinkler fire-extinguishing system is the decontamination system of a set of specialty, when intelligence quarantine passage detects that personnel have fever or other abnormal conditions, control system can send a command to embedded controller, embedded controller is ordered retransmiting spray after order analysis to automatic sprinkler fire-extinguishing system, target can be carried out spray when automatic sprinkler fire-extinguishing system receives spray order and disinfect.
